[packages/python-backports-ssl_match_hostname] - pl
qboosh
qboosh at pld-linux.org
Sun Mar 27 18:11:09 CEST 2016
commit 82817d98eec426aeaa2273da680257e6a81fa41f
Author: Jakub Bogusz <qboosh at pld-linux.org>
Date: Sun Mar 27 18:11:03 2016 +0200
- pl
python-backports-ssl_match_hostname.spec | 28 ++++++++++++++++++++++------
1 file changed, 22 insertions(+), 6 deletions(-)
---
diff --git a/python-backports-ssl_match_hostname.spec b/python-backports-ssl_match_hostname.spec
index f85ef0c..7dc0a17 100644
--- a/python-backports-ssl_match_hostname.spec
+++ b/python-backports-ssl_match_hostname.spec
@@ -1,17 +1,18 @@
%define module_name backports.ssl_match_hostname
Summary: The ssl.match_hostname() function from Python 3
+Summary(pl.UTF-8): Funkcja ssl.match_hostname() z Pythona 3
Name: python-backports-ssl_match_hostname
Version: 3.5.0.1
Release: 1
-License: Python
+License: PSF v2
Group: Libraries/Python
-# Source0Download: https://pypi.python.org/pypi/backports.ssl_match_hostname
-Source0: http://pypi.python.org/packages/source/b/%{module_name}/%{module_name}-%{version}.tar.gz
+# Source0Download: https://pypi.python.org/simple/backports.ssl-match-hostname/
+Source0: https://pypi.python.org/packages/source/b/backports.ssl_match_hostname/%{module_name}-%{version}.tar.gz
# Source0-md5: c03fc5e2c7b3da46b81acf5cbacfe1e6
URL: https://bitbucket.org/brandon/backports.ssl_match_hostname
-BuildRequires: python-setuptools
+BuildRequires: python-modules >= 1:2.4
BuildRequires: rpm-pythonprov
-BuildRequires: rpmbuild(macros) >= 1.710
+BuildRequires: rpmbuild(macros) >= 1.714
Requires: python-backports
BuildArch: noarch
BuildRoot: %{tmpdir}/%{name}-%{version}-root-%(id -u -n)
@@ -31,10 +32,25 @@ check separately.
This backport brings match_hostname() to users of earlier versions of
Python. The actual code inside comes verbatim from Python 3.2.
+%description -l pl.UTF-8
+Warstwa bezpiecznych gniazd (Secure Sockets Layer) jest naprawdę
+bezpieczna tylko jeśli sprawdza się nazwę hosta w certyfikacie
+zwracanym przez serwer, z którym się łączy i weryfikuje, że zgadza się
+ona z pożądaną nazwą hosta.
+
+Ale logika dopasowująca, zdefiniowana w RFC2818, może być nietrywialna
+do zaimplementowania samemu. Dlatego też pakiet ssl biblioteki
+standardowej Pythona 3.2 zawiera teraz funkcję match_hostname(), która
+wykonuje to sprawdzenie zamiast wymagania implementacji w każdej
+aplikacji.
+
+Ten backport udostępnia match_hostname() użytkownikom wcześniejszych
+wersji Pythona. Sam kod pochodzi bez zmian z Pythona 3.2.
+
%prep
%setup -qn %{module_name}-%{version}
-mv backports/ssl_match_hostname/*.txt .
+%{__mv} backports/ssl_match_hostname/*.txt .
touch backports/ssl_match_hostname/README.txt
%build
================================================================
---- gitweb:
http://git.pld-linux.org/gitweb.cgi/packages/python-backports-ssl_match_hostname.git/commitdiff/82817d98eec426aeaa2273da680257e6a81fa41f
More information about the pld-cvs-commit
mailing list